Articoli con tag linq

[Visual C#] : Novità del linguaggio

0

Ecco alcune delle nuove caratteristiche aggiunte al linguaggio Visual C# :

  • Local Type Inference (tipizzazione implicita) : il compilatore determina il tipo dei dati delle variabili locali in base ai valori utilizzati per inizializzarle.
  • Object Initializer (inizializzatori di oggetti) : è ora possibile inizializzare un oggetto dati complesso in un’espressione, senza una chiamata esplicita ad un costruttore.
  • (continua…)

[C#] : Come scansionare un Array con LINQ

0
using System;
using System.Collections;
using System.Collections.Generic;
namespace ForEachExaple
{
     public static class Utility
     {
         public static void ForEach(this IEnumerable coll, Action function)
         {
            IEnumerator en = coll.GetEnumerator();
            while (en.MoveNext())
            function(en.Current);
          }
     }
class Program
{
   static void Main(string[] args)
   {
      var array = new int[] { 1, 2, 3 };
      //Output : 123
      array.ForEach(val => Console.Write(val));
    }
 }
}

last60 225x300 [C#] : Come scansionare un Array con LINQ

Torna all'inizio